The cast and crew of "Marvel's The Avengers" were riding high the day after the world premiere of their film. Fans, celebrities and journalists couldn't help but tweet out their ecstatic reactions to the long-await film, and it had seemed that Joss Whedon and friends may have finally put together the film we were all hoping for.


But at a press conference the next evening, Robert Downey, Jr., stated that they weren't finished just yet. The actor said that the cast was filming an additional scene that very night. The audience laughed at what seemed to be a joke from the notoriously wry Downey, but he assured the crowd saying, "I'm not kidding." He then promptly ended the press conference, leaving the world abuzz.


This was the first anyone had heard of a last minute scene, so at a later press conference, one writer put the question to director Joss Whedon, who denied the planned shoot. It seemed that lid had been blown off Downey's joke, but The Playlist caught up with Mark Ruffalo later, who confirmed the shoot.



"We're shooting a scene tonight. I'm not sure exactly where it's gonna go. All I know is that someone came in with the costume and said, 'Here's some wardrobe. We don't know where you're going to be or what you're doing.' " Ruffalo said. We asked if it will be in the "The Avengers" when it hits theaters Ruffalo added, "Yeah. So I'm like, 'All right, when are we doing that?' Today after we're done."


But what could it be? A complete film screened for a packed audience just the day before. The gut reaction for a secret Marvel shoot would point in the direction of a post-credit sequence, but one already appeared during the premiere screening.


With "Iron Man 3" the next film on Marvel's docket, many writers pointed to a potential connection to that film which involved the entire cast of "The Avengers." With so many A-listers on the cast, it would be near impossible to coordinate their schedules after the press schedule to film a scene together. This last minute shoot may have been Marvel's way around that.
